OFCCP Announces Three Multimillion Dollar Bias Settlements

Polsinelli | | Return|
The OFCCP opened the month of October by announcing three multimillion dollar settlements with major government contractors.  The agency entered into early resolution conciliation agreements with Goldman Sachs & Co. LLC and Dell Technologies, Inc. to...
